If you asking how far a FDC be located from a hydrant, then the answer is as follows:
NFPA 13 - Does not have a requirement. NFPA 14 - Has a requirement. 6.4.5.4: Fire department connections shall be located not more than 100 ft (30.5 m) from the nearest fire hydrant connected to an approved water supply.
